A sickly scientist who was snubbed by Tony Stark once, and built a terrorist movement out of the grudge.

Aldrich Killian co-developed Extremis, the virus that rewrites a body, and founded Advanced Idea Mechanics to sell what it could do. Guy Pearce plays him in two registers: the sickly man Tony Stark brushed off years before, and the polished one who comes back cured, with a private army of Extremis-enhanced soldiers and a plan to ruin Stark.

The plan is the Mandarin. Killian hires an actor to front a series of terrorist broadcasts, so the world has a face to fear while A.I.M.’s failed Extremis experiments, which tend to explode, get blamed on him. Maya Hansen’s research is the science; Killian is the one who turned it into a business.

He is killed by Pepper Potts, who has been given Extremis herself by then and turns out to be better at it than he is.

The reveal that the Mandarin was an actor, and that Killian was the real one, was the most argued-about decision in the film. Many comic readers objected to what it did to a major villain; others defended it for the social commentary and for sidestepping the racist caricature of the comics’ Mandarin. The series answered eight years later in Shang-Chi and the Legend of the Ten Rings, which introduced the actual leader of the Ten Rings, Xu Wenwu, and the actor, Trevor Slattery, who had been playing his name.

Extremis, which gives him heat, regeneration, and a body he did not have before.
